Postman Alternatives
Rank | App | Description | Tags | Stars |
---|---|---|---|---|
1 | hoppscotch/hoppscotch | 👽 Open source API development ecosystem - https://hoppscotch.io | hacktoberfest developer-tools vuejs pwa vue websocket tools api graphql rest-api http rest spa api-client api-rest api-testing http-client testing testing-tools | 59978 |
2 | EsperoTech/yaade | Yaade is an open-source, self-hosted, collaborative API development environment. | docker selfhosted typescript api h2-database hoppscotch kotlin postman | 1388 |
Best Open Source Self-Hosted Apps for Postman
1. Insomnia
Insomnia is an open-source tool that allows developers to interact with HTTP APIs like a human, making it easier and faster to test web services. It offers features such as built-in support for GraphQL, REST, SOAP, and more, environment variables, and team sharing capabilities.
2. Hoppscotch
Hoppscotch is an open source API development ecosystem that makes it easy to create, share, and run APIs using a graphical interface. It offers features like code generation, mock server, environment variables, and more.
3. Paw
Paw is a full-featured and beautiful Mac app for interacting with REST services, SOAP web services, and HTTP servers. It allows you to construct requests, inspect responses, visualize the data flow, and generate client code in popular programming languages like JavaScript, Objective-C, or Python.
4. Restlet Client
Restlet is a powerful open source API platform that provides tools for designing, testing, documenting, and managing APIs. It supports REST, GraphQL, SOAP, and more protocols, and allows you to import OpenAPI specifications to streamline your workflow.
5. Postwoman
Postwoman is an open-source tool that enables developers to create HTTP requests using a beautiful, user-friendly interface. It offers features like form data, file uploads, binary files, and more, making it easy to manage complex API interactions.
Each of these tools has its own unique set of features and capabilities that make them suitable for different types of projects or tasks. The best one for you depends on your specific needs and the APIs you're working with.